Frequently Asked Questions
What capacitance and voltage rating does the TAJS335K006RNJ provide for power supply decoupling?
The TAJS335K006RNJ offers 3.3µF capacitance at a 6V rating, making it appropriate for decoupling 3.3V and 5V supply rails in digital and mixed-signal circuits. Its ESR of 9000mΩ measured at 100kHz is typical of standard tantalum capacitors and should be considered when designing high-frequency decoupling networks.
How does the solid tantalum construction of the TAJS335K006RNJ affect its reliability compared to wet tantalum or aluminum electrolytic capacitors?
Solid tantalum capacitors like the TAJS335K006RNJ use a dry/solid tantalum pentoxide dielectric, which eliminates the liquid electrolyte found in wet aluminum electrolytics and avoids electrolyte drying or leakage failures. This results in longer operational life and stable 3.3µF capacitance retention across a wider temperature range, making them preferred in applications where reliability over years of service is required.
In what situations would an engineer select the TAJS335K006RNJ over a multilayer ceramic capacitor for 3.3V rail decoupling?
Engineers select the TAJS335K006RNJ when they require stable 3.3µF capacitance with minimal variation under DC bias, since ceramic capacitors with Class II dielectrics can lose significant capacitance at their rated voltage. Although the 9000mΩ ESR at 100kHz of the tantalum is higher than most ceramic types, its predictable capacitance behavior over temperature and bias makes it preferable in precision analog power supply filtering applications.
